Considerations on Improvement of Moving Properties of Cable-less Magnetic Micro-actuator

Abstract: This paper proposes a new cable-less magnetic micro-actuator that operates on the inertia force of a one-degree-of-freedom model by using electromagnetic force. It has optimal design for the inclination angle of the one-degree-of-freedom model and an appropriate selection of suction force at the actuator support. The mechanical dc-ac inverter incorporates a cantilever beam and the one-degree-of-freedom model that switches under electromagnetic force.
